Golden Yellow is a light vivid yellow with a warm undertone. To deepen it, Warm Yellow is the darker step in the same Monument Pro Acryl range. Golden Yellow is a little less common: the closest same-finish match, AK Interactive Interior Yellow Green, reaches 82 percent, and 1 other brand carries a strong same-finish alternative. Cross-brand swaps are adjust-on-model territory here, useful as a starting point rather than an exact replacement.
Golden Yellow equivalents in other ranges
Golden Yellow is awkward to replace. Treat the matches below as starting points for a mix rather than straight swaps.
Closest AK Interactive equivalent: AK Interactive Interior Yellow Green, a near match with visible drift up close (delta E 3.7).
From Scale75: Scale75 Sol Yellow, a usable stand-in rather than a twin (delta E 4.3).
Tamiya's closest color: Tamiya Ace Yellow, workable at tabletop distance, not up close (delta E 5.1).
Nearest in the Vallejo catalog: Vallejo Buff, a usable stand-in rather than a twin (delta E 6.1).
The drift here is spread thinly across hue, lightness and saturation rather than leaning one way, so the mismatch reads as a general haze at delta E 3.7 rather than an obvious shift.

What is the closest equivalent to Monument Pro Acryl Golden Yellow?
The closest same-finish match is AK Interactive Interior Yellow Green at 82% color similarity.
What color is Golden Yellow?
Golden Yellow is a light vivid yellow with a warm undertone (hex #C8A509).
What do I highlight and shade Golden Yellow with?
Shade Golden Yellow with Warm Yellow in the same Monument Pro Acryl range. For highlights, mix in a lighter tone or move to a brighter paint in the lane.
